Transaction 899302ace369f3239c1ed48fccc4218bf9f630df4bfe0d8cbf57065874a5217a
1 Input
1 Output
-
899302ace369f3239c1ed48fccc4218bf9f630df4bfe0d8cbf57065874a5217a:0
- value
- 478736
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3fa3b81483e3de7ae532d8b8a964cce3b63875f
- address
- bc1qc0arhq2g8c770tjn9k9c49jvecak8p6l3mqe88